Call for Papers: Muslims of the UK and Europe Postgraduate Symposium
Organised
by the Prince Alwaleed Bin Talal Centre of Islamic Studies at the
University of Cambridge
The
Centre of Islamic Studies invites applications from current Masters and PhD
candidates to present their research on issues pertaining to Muslims of the UK
and Europe, from any discipline. This postgraduate symposium, taking place
on 29th/30th September 2025 at the Moller Centre in
Cambridge, will be a platform for students to present and exchange current
research on any topic in this field in a dynamic forum. Papers should present,
analyse or interpret research findings, data or material. Participants are
expected to attend all sessions. Accommodation will be provided and economy
travel expenses will be reimbursed up to £300.
To apply
please submit a 500-word abstract, with curriculum vitae outlining current
research interests, to admin@cis.cam.ac.uk by 15 January
2025.
Successful
candidates will be notified at the start of March 2025 and invited to submit
draft papers of no more than 3000 words by 1 Sept 2025.
